Skip to main content

2,727 Used BMW 1 Series cars for sale

BMW 1 Series2023 (73) - M135i xDrive 5dr Step Auto

2023 (73) - M135i xDrive 5dr Step Auto21

£32,000

  • 2L
  • 13.4K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Listers Kings Lynn (BMW)

01553601557 *

BMW 1 Series2012 (12) - 116d EfficientDynamics 5dr

2012 (12) - 116d EfficientDynamics 5dr20

£2,295

  • 1.6L
  • 115.3K

    Miles
  • Diesel
  • Manual
  • Hatchback

S&O AUTOMOTIVE LTD

01143089077 *

BMW 1 Series2019 - 3.0 M140i Shadow Edition 5-door

2019 - 3.0 M140i Shadow Edition 5-door33

£20,495

Finance available £400 pm

  • 3L
  • 55.8K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Goldheart Automotive

01483910967 *

BMW 1 Series2025 (25) - 120 M Sport 5dr Step Auto [Pro Pack] Petrol Hatchback

2025 (25) - 120 M Sport 5dr Step Auto [Pro Pack] Petrol Hatchback44

£35,000

  • 1.5L
  • 2.9K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Vertu BMW Sunderland

01918146399 *

0/5 Stars

BMW 1 Series2020 (70) - 2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)

2020 (70) - 2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)36

£23,995

Finance available £472 pm

  • 2L
  • 45.4K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Hatt Service Centre

01752973301 *

BMW 1 Series2015 (65) - 118i [1.5] M Sport 5dr

2015 (65) - 118i [1.5] M Sport 5dr20

£6,995

Finance available £134 pm

  • 1.5L
  • 104.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Three Pines Garage Limited

01885477786 *

0/5 Stars

BMW 1 Series2020 (20) - 1.5 118i M Sport DCT Euro 6 (s/s) 5dr

2020 (20) - 1.5 118i M Sport DCT Euro 6 (s/s) 5dr51

£16,995

Finance available £357 pm

  • 1.5L
  • 60.0K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Precision Motor Group

02039537318 *

BMW 1 Series2020 (20) - 1.5 118i Sport Hatchback 5dr

2020 (20) - 1.5 118i Sport Hatchback 5dr7

£15,599

  • 1.5L
  • 43.1K

    Miles
  • Petrol
  • Manual
  • Hatchback

Bridgend Motor Group - Kilmarnock Autoplex

01563590183 *

BMW 1 Series2018 (68) - 3.0 M140i Shadow Edition Hatchback 5dr Petrol Auto Euro 6 (s/s) (340 ps)

2018 (68) - 3.0 M140i Shadow Edition Hatchback 5dr Petrol Auto Euro 6 (s/s) (340 ps)50

£16,796

Finance available £353 pm

  • 3L
  • 88.1K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Tenby Car Supermarket

01582280726 *

BMW 1 Series2014 (64) - 120d M Sport 5dr

2014 (64) - 120d M Sport 5dr7

£3,999

Finance available £67 pm

  • 2L
  • 123.0K

    Miles
  • Diesel
  • Manual
  • Hatchback

MDLUXEAUTO

01162166642 *

BMW 1 Series2020 (20) - 1.5 118i M Sport Hatchback 5dr Petrol DCT Euro 6 (s/s) (140 ps)

2020 (20) - 1.5 118i M Sport Hatchback 5dr Petrol DCT Euro 6 (s/s) (140 ps)48

Low Mileage

£20,988

  • 1.5L
  • 26.7K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Jeff White Motors

02920028289 *

4.7/5 Stars

BMW 1 Series2023 - 118i [136] M Sport 5dr Step Auto [LCP]

2023 - 118i [136] M Sport 5dr Step Auto [LCP]35

Low Mileage

£24,495

  • 1.5L
  • 8.2K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Stratstone BMW Bury St Edmunds

01284338953 *

4.4/5 Stars

BMW 1 Series2015 (65) - 1.5 116d ED Plus Euro 6 (s/s) 5dr

2015 (65) - 1.5 116d ED Plus Euro 6 (s/s) 5dr48

£4,700

Finance available £83 pm

  • 1.5L
  • 130.5K

    Miles
  • Diesel
  • Manual
  • Hatchback

The Car Hub (Midlands)

01623703437 *

BMW 1 Series2017 (66) - 1.5 118i Sport Hatchback 5dr Petrol Manual Euro 6 (s/s) (136 ps)

2017 (66) - 1.5 118i Sport Hatchback 5dr Petrol Manual Euro 6 (s/s) (136 ps)32

£7,999

Finance available £156 pm

  • 1.5L
  • 72.1K

    Miles
  • Petrol
  • Manual
  • Hatchback

Zeus Cars Limited

01234237525 *

0/5 Stars

BMW 1 Series2020 - 1.5 118i SE Hatchback 5dr Petrol DCT Euro 6 (s/s) (140 ps)

2020 - 1.5 118i SE Hatchback 5dr Petrol DCT Euro 6 (s/s) (140 ps)35

£13,049

Finance available £275 pm

  • 1.5L
  • 70.5K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Carbase - Bristol

01172331396 *

4.4/5 Stars

BMW 1 Series2019 - BMW 1 Series 2.0 120i GPF M Sport Shadow Edition Hatchback 5dr Petrol Auto

2019 - BMW 1 Series 2.0 120i GPF M Sport Shadow Edition Hatchback 5dr Petrol Auto96

Low Mileage

£15,849

  • 2L
  • 36.4K

    Miles
  • Petrol
  • Semi Auto
  • Hatchback

Norton Way Peugeot

01462411083 *

BMW 1 Series2018 (67) - 1.5 116d M Sport Shadow Edition Hatchback 3dr Diesel Manual Euro 6 (s/s) (1

2018 (67) - 1.5 116d M Sport Shadow Edition Hatchback 3dr Diesel Manual Euro 6 (s/s) (132

Low Mileage

£12,000

Finance available £246 pm

  • 1.5L
  • 47.4K

    Miles
  • Diesel
  • Manual
  • Hatchback

Catalina Of Stanningley

01134675328 *

BMW 1 Series2011 (11) - 2.0 116d ES Euro 5 (s/s) 3dr

2011 (11) - 2.0 116d ES Euro 5 (s/s) 3dr41

Low Mileage

£2,495

  • 2L
  • 111.0K

    Miles
  • Diesel
  • Manual
  • Hatchback

Renown Motors

01613887637 *

BMW 1 Series2011 (11) - 116i [2.0] Sport 3dr - FULL SERVICE

2011 (11) - 116i [2.0] Sport 3dr - FULL SERVICE17

Low Mileage

£3,490

Finance available £56 pm

  • 2L
  • 55.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

MAK Automobiles Limited

01613887756 *

BMW 1 Series2017 (17) - 3.0 M140i Auto Euro 6 (s/s) 5dr

2017 (17) - 3.0 M140i Auto Euro 6 (s/s) 5dr58

Low Mileage

£18,995

Finance available £370 pm

  • 3L
  • 44.0K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Precision Motor Group

02039537318 *

Why buy a used BMW 1 Series?

If you're in the market for a car that's practical, fun to drive and stylish, then a used BMW 1 Series is a fantastic choice. With BMW build quality, a used 1 Series provides luxury motoring at an affordable price. The interior offers supportive seating, high-tech features and upscale materials that provide a refined driving experience.

Used BMW 1 Series snapshot review

Pros

  • Economical diesels
  • Fun to drive
  • Excellent build quality

Cons

  • Lack of hybrid/electric model
  • Limited cabin and boot space
  • Firm ride

BMW 1 Series video review

Buying a used car checklist: what to look for

Buying a used car checklist: what to look for

Buying a used car can be a daunting task, but with our checklist, you can make sure you’re getting the best deal possible.

View guides

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.